我一直在尝试滚动到div id jquery代码以正常工作。基于另一个堆栈溢出问题,我尝试了以下操作
$('#myButton').click(function() { $.scrollTo($('#myDiv'), 1000); });
但这没有用。它只是捕捉到div。我也试过
$('#myButton').click(function(event) { event.preventDefault(); $.scrollTo($('#myDiv'), 1000); });
没有进展。
您需要设置动画 html, body
html, body
$("#button").click(function() { $('html, body').animate({ scrollTop: $("#myDiv").offset().top }, 2000); });